Output 59613bc7f488f46c63cc4d36a38d6c82609a6c6b3499f3c99bce1efa9c74c24a:0

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98694b160ef3435cfc24f88e5e8507a8d4bd9759 OP_EQUAL
address
3FatmcHEAvkKD8eo82rWd58SQN4y669vGg
transaction
59613bc7f488f46c63cc4d36a38d6c82609a6c6b3499f3c99bce1efa9c74c24a
spent
true